Preparation
Sauté the strips of Speck Alto Adige PGI and radicchio in butter. Add white wine vinegar, dust with flour, and then pour in the milk. Let simmer for approx. 10 minutes and season with salt and nutmeg. Fill the cooked sheets of dough with the béchamel sauce and shaved cheese and bake for approx. 40 min at 180 °C.
